Ingredients
To craft your own luscious Cheesy Hamburger Rice Casserole, here’s what you’ll need:
- 1 lb ground beef: The star of the dish, offering that rich, savory flavor.
- 2 cups cooked rice: A delicious base; white or brown rice works wonderfully!
- 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ese: Because what’s cheesy without cheese? This adds that melty goodness we crave.
- 1 can cream of mushroom soup: A creamy binder that takes this dish to the next level.
- 1 cup milk: To ensure everything stays nice and moist.
- ½ cup diced onions: For an aromatic kick.
- Salt and pepper: To taste, the essential seasoning duo!
- Optional veggies (like peas or bell peppers): To sneak in some nutrition and color.
For substitutions, consider using ground turkey or chicken for a leaner option, or switch out the cheese for dairy-free varieties. The casserole is as adaptable as your culinary creativity allows!

Step-by-Step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). This will ensure a warm, toasty environment for your casserole.
- Cook the rice according to package instructions, then set aside. Your kitchen will already begin to smell delightful!
- In a skillet, brown the ground beef over medium heat until fully cooked. Add diced onions and sauté until they become translucent.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
- In a large mixing bowl, combine the cooked rice, browned beef mixture, cream of mushroom soup, and milk. Stir until well mixed.
- Transfer the mixture into a greased baking dish. Spread it evenly, making sure every nook and cranny is filled.
- Top with shredded cheddar cheese, sprinkling it generously across the surface.
- Bake in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es, or until the cheese is bubbly and golden brown.
- Let it sit for a few minutes before serving; it will be hard to resist that cheesy goodness!
Tips and Variations
- Add Fresh Vegetables: Feel free to fold in frozen peas, corn, or diced bell peppers for added nutrition and texture.
- Spicy Kick: Mix in diced jalapeños or a sprinkle of cayenne pepper for those who enjoy a bit of heat.
- Herb Infusion: A sprinkle of fresh parsley or thyme before serving adds a lovely aromatic touch.

Storage and Make-Ahead Tips
If you find yourself with leftovers (if you can!), store them airtight in the fridge for up to 3 days. This Cheesy Hamburger Rice Casserole also freezes beautifully—simply defrost overnight in the fridge before reheating. To reheat, pop it in the microwave or oven until warm throughout. FAQs
Can I make this casserole ahead of time?
Absolutely! Assemble the casserole in advance and store it in the fridge until you’re ready to bake.
What can I serve with Cheesy Hamburger Rice Casserole?
Great companions include a fresh garden salad, crusty garlic bread, or roasted vegetables.
Is there a vegetarian version of this dish?
Yes! Swap the ground beef for lentils or a plant-based meat alternative and use vegetable broth instead of beef broth.
Can I freeze Cheesy Hamburger Rice Casserole?
Yes! It freezes well—simply wrap it tightly before storing. Just thaw and reheat when you’re ready to enjoy it.
What type of cheese works best?
Cheddar is classic, but feel free to mix in Monterey Jack or even mozzarella for a gooey, delicious topping!
